    For some reason once again the current trend in Hollywood is to remake old movies. Yes, I know this is not something new, but a prime example of a remake that probably is not needed to be made is The Karate Kid. However, today we learned that Will Smith's son Jaden has been cast to play The Karate Kid.

    Here is the story:

    Columbia Pictures is back in the dojo with a new version of the 1984 hit "The Karate Kid," which has been refashioned as a star vehicle for Jaden Smith.

    The film will be produced by Jerry Weintraub (who launched the original franchise) and Overbrook Entertainment's James Lassiter, Will Smith and Ken Stovitz. Will Smith, who is the 10-year-old actor's father, co-starred alongside Jaden in his feature debut, "The Pursuit of Happyness," which Overbrook and Escape Artists produced for Columbia.

    The script is being written by Chris Murphy, and the film will shoot next year in Beijing and other cities. While the new film will be set in that exotic locale, it will borrow elements of the original plot, wherein a bullied youth learns to stand up for himself with the help of an eccentric mentor.

    China Film Group Corp. will co-produce in China.

    Source: Variety
